About this listen
When you were a kid, Halloween wasn’t a holiday — it was a war zone.
In this first episode of Remember When Radio, Adam L’Heureux looks back at a time when fireworks, costumes, and chaos filled the streets. What starts as nostalgia for candy bags and bottle rockets turns into something deeper — a reflection on freedom, friendship, and how those wild nights shaped who we are today.
